5 самых больших проблем при разработке приложений

Интернет

У вас есть уникальная, по вашему мнению, идея для разработки приложения. Или вы являетесь компанией электронной коммерции, которая понимает необходимость разработки приложения, чтобы быть конкурентоспособной на своем рынке. Скорее всего, вы не являетесь техническим специалистом, готовым сделать это самостоятельно. Вы воспользуетесь услугами разработчика приложений.

5 самых больших проблем при разработке приложений

Вы можете подумать, что можете просто передать все разработчику, но подумайте еще раз. Вам придется следить за процессом разработки и конечным продуктом, потому что впереди вас ждут некоторые трудности.

Оглавление

  • 1. Прежде чем обратиться к разработчику, нужно принять решение
  • 2. Понимание потребности в экранах
  • 3. Решение о типах взаимодействия
  • 4. Решения о локализации
  • 5. Выбор правильного разработчика
  • Не единственные проблемы при разработке приложений

1. Прежде чем обратиться к разработчику, необходимо принять решения

Вы должны определить и записать несколько вещей:

  • Кто ваша целевая аудитория для этого приложения? Вы должны проанализировать свою целевую аудиторию, поскольку это определит язык, стиль, визуальные средства, медиа и т.д., которые вы захотите использовать.
  • Какова цель вашего приложения, как оно решит проблему или облегчит или упростит жизнь вашей аудитории?
  • Кто ваши конкуренты, и как вы можете предложить что-то лучшее или уникальное?
  • Как вы будете зарабатывать деньги на этом приложении? Если у вас есть сайт электронной коммерции,это произойдет за счет увеличения продаж. Если у вас есть отдельное приложение, будет ли установлена цена на премиум-версию? Будете ли вы включать платную рекламу?
  • Где будет опубликовано ваше приложение? Если это приложение только для веб-сайта, то нет проблем. Но независимые автономные приложения, скорее всего, попадут в магазины Google Play и Apple, один или оба.
  • Есть ли рынок для вашего отдельного приложения? Вам необходимо провести анализ рынка, чтобы убедиться, что ваше приложение будет востребовано на рынке.

Вся эта информация должна быть предоставлена вашему разработчику, и она является частью общепринятых 6 шагов по разработке успешного приложения.

2. Понимание необходимости экранов

Мобильные устройства превзошли использование персональных компьютеров несколько лет назад. Это касается и использования приложений. Мобильные устройства имеют разные размеры экранов, а также уникальные требования к операционным системам, интенсивности пикселей и т.д.

Если вы разрабатываете только для самой последней платформы, ваше приложение не будет хорошо работать для многих пользователей. Ответ — отзывчивый дизайн, который имеет ликвидное представление на всех устройствах, но это будет сложный процесс для любого разработчика, которого вы выберете.

3. Решите, какие типы взаимодействия вам нужны

Приложения должны быть интерактивными, чтобы дать пользователям наилучший опыт и позволить им делиться, оставлять отзывы и многое другое. Определите типы интерактивных функций, которые вам нужны, и убедитесь, что любой выбранный вами разработчик сможет их реализовать.

И помните, чтоВзаимодействия включают такие вещи, как пролистывание, касания, кнопки и другие варианты «нажатия», а также перелистывание для определения позиции и т.д.

4. Решения по локализации

Вы должны быть уверены, что ваш разработчик применяет локализацию в своем коде, чтобы вы могли установить другие языковые базы, даже если вы не делаете этого прямо сейчас. Вам понадобится перевод текста и других функций. Просмотрите лучшие варианты сайтов переводов и выберите тот, который имеет опыт перевода приложений.

5. Выбор правильного разработчика

Это, пожалуй, самая сложная задача из всех. Вы знаете, чего хотите от своего приложения; вы определили свою аудиторию и ценность, которую вы можете предоставить. Если вы хотите увеличить охват и предложить свое приложение пользователям по всему миру, обратитесь к компаниям, предоставляющим услуги перевода, чтобы локализовать его.

Затем очень важно найти разработчика, который сможет воплотить все это в жизнь. Существует множество разработчиков приложений, и вам придется потратить некоторое время на изучение их возможностей. Вам нужно будет посмотреть их портфолио; вам нужно будет проверить рекомендации.

Вы ищете разработчиков, которые были успешны, по крайней мере, в нишах, связанных с целью, аудиторией и содержанием вашего приложения. Составьте контрольный список всего, что вам нужно от разработчика, и ответьте на каждый из этих пунктов.

Не единственные проблемы разработки приложений

Эти пять проблем должны быть первостепенными в вашем сознании прямо сейчас, но впереди еще много других — обновления,маркетинг, будущая экспансия на мировые рынки — и это только некоторые из них. Если вы предусмотрите эти пять вещей с самого начала, вы будете на верном пути.

Оцените статью
IT советы и лайфхаки, windows, технологии